Esophageal HRM & Impedance-pH2-day MMS Pediatric Training Coursein cooperation with Michiel van Wijk (MD)Medical Measurement Systems (MMS) is proud to offer a practice-based course on Pediatric upper GI function testing on December 6-7, 2011, with the emphasis on the new techniques High Resolution Manometry (HRM) and 24-hour ambulatory Impedance-pH monitoring. Additionally, anorectal manometry and HRAM has been added to the program. Subsequent to the workshop the Emma Children’s Hospital/AMC in Amsterdam will organize the 5th European Pediatric Motility Meeting (December 8-10, 2011).
